Code C1020 Description

The Anti-Lock Brake System (ABS) Module monitors the Left Rear Wheel Speed Sensor. The ABS Module sets the OBDII code when the Left Rear Wheel Speed Sensor is not to factory specifications.

What are the Possible Causes of the DTC C1020?

  • Faulty Left Rear Wheel Speed Sensor
  • Left Rear Wheel Speed Sensor harness is open or shorted
  • Left Rear Wheel Speed Sensor circuit poor electrical connection
  • Faulty Anti-Lock Brake System (ABS) Module

How to Fix the DTC C1020?

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the C1020 code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.

Frequently Asked Questions about C1020 Code

1. What are common symptoms of OBDII code C1020?

- Common symptoms include the ABS warning light illuminating on the dashboard, traction control issues, and potential loss of stability control.

2. What does OBDII code C1020 indicate?

- OBDII code C1020 indicates a fault in the left rear wheel speed sensor circuit.

3. What are possible causes of OBDII code C1020?

- Possible causes include a faulty wheel speed sensor, damaged wiring or connectors in the circuit, or issues with the ABS module.

4. How can I diagnose the cause of OBDII code C1020?

- Diagnosing the issue involves performing a visual inspection of the wiring and connectors, testing the wheel speed sensor, and using a scan tool to read data from the ABS system.

5. Can I still drive my vehicle with OBDII code C1020?

- It is not recommended to drive your vehicle with OBDII code C1020, as it can affect the proper functioning of your ABS and stability control systems.

6. How can I repair OBDII code C1020?

- Repairing OBDII code C1020 may involve replacing the left rear wheel speed sensor, repairing damaged wiring or connectors, or addressing any issues with the ABS module.

7. Will OBDII code C1020 cause my vehicle to fail an emissions test?

- OBDII code C1020 is related to the ABS system and should not cause your vehicle to fail an emissions test.

8. Is it possible to reset OBDII code C1020 without fixing the underlying issue?

- While you can reset the code temporarily, it will likely reappear until the underlying issue with the left rear wheel speed sensor circuit is addressed.

9. Can extreme weather conditions trigger OBDII code C1020?

- Extreme weather conditions can potentially contribute to issues with the wheel speed sensor circuit, leading to the triggering of OBDII code C1020.

10. How much does it typically cost to repair OBDII code C1020?

- Repair costs for OBDII code C1020 can vary depending on the cause of the issue, but it may range from $100 to $300 for parts and labor.
